Cashing out from Jackpot Daily follows the standard US sweepstakes casino pattern: meet the 1× playthrough on your SC, reach at least 100 SC redemption minimum, complete KYC verification, and submit a bank transfer request. Funds typically arrive in 3 to 5 business days.

Jackpot Daily’s redemption threshold is 100 SC for cash redemption via bank transfer. At the 1 SC = $1 USD conversion rate, that’s a $100 USD minimum cashout.
How this compares:
| Casino | Min Cash Cashout |
|---|---|
| McLuck | 10 SC (gift cards) / 50 SC (cash) |
| MegaBonanza | 10 SC (gift cards) |
| Stake.us | 25 SC (crypto) |
| Jackpot Daily | 100 SC |
| Some legacy platforms | 50-100 SC |
The 100 SC threshold sits on the higher end of the market. McLuck’s 10 SC gift card option lets new players cash out faster, but only in gift card form. Jackpot Daily’s 100 SC requires you to accumulate more before your first redemption.
For context, the welcome bonus Package 3 at $49.99 delivers 100 SC in a single purchase, clearing the redemption minimum on day one (after 1× playthrough).
Every SC bonus credited to your Jackpot Daily account — welcome, daily sign-in, VIP, referrals, Sunday Mystery, Monthly Grand, Rescue Bonus, all of them — carries a 1× playthrough before becoming redeemable.
1× means: You must wager your SC balance once on eligible games before it can be cashed out.

If you wager 30 SC and end up with 45 SC (you won some hands), all 45 SC is redeemable. If you wager 30 SC and end up with 15 SC (you lost some), the remaining 15 SC is redeemable.
The 1× rate is the industry standard floor. Stake.us requires 3× (significantly harder to clear). Jackpot Daily’s 1× is one of the most player-friendly playthrough rates in sweepstakes.
Before your first redemption, you must complete Know Your Customer (KYC) verification. This is a US sweepstakes legal requirement, not a Jackpot Daily-specific imposition.

Verification timeline: Usually completes within 24 to 48 hours after document upload. Some cases clear in under an hour; complex cases (mismatched name/address, lower-quality document scans) may take longer.
Critical tip: Submit KYC documents on day one of your Jackpot Daily account, before you have anything to redeem. By the time your SC balance is redemption-ready, KYC will already be cleared and your first cashout will process at full speed.
The total time from request submission to funds in your bank is typically 4 to 7 business days for first-time redemptions, dropping to 3 to 5 business days for subsequent ones.
Based on current Jackpot Daily documentation, the primary cashout method is bank transfer (ACH). Other methods like crypto, gift cards, PayPal, or wire transfer are not currently published as options.

If you submit a redemption request before clearing the 1× playthrough, the request will be rejected. The dashboard typically shows remaining playthrough requirement clearly — but if you’re uncertain, check.
Fix: Place additional wagers on eligible slot games until the requirement clears. Eligible games typically include all slots; some table games may contribute less than 100% toward the playthrough.
SC that’s been credited but not manually claimed from the Reward Center may not count toward your redeemable balance. Common with Rescue Bonus, VIP Daily/Weekly rewards, and Sunday Mystery.
Fix: Visit the Reward Center, claim all pending rewards, then submit your redemption.
If your KYC documents show an address in one of the 15 restricted states, your account will be flagged and redemption denied.
Fix: This is generally final — players in restricted states cannot redeem from Jackpot Daily. Alternative platforms with different state lists may be available.
A typo in your routing number or account number will bounce the transfer. The bounce typically takes 2-3 business days to detect.
Fix: Double-check bank details before submitting. The redemption can be resubmitted after correcting the info, but you’ll lose the days spent on the bounced attempt.

A new player who completes KYC on Day 1, plays through their welcome SC by Day 2-3, and submits redemption on Day 4 can realistically receive funds by Day 9-10. Less proactive players may take 14+ days.
Jackpot Daily’s cashout process is standard, reliable, and player-friendly on playthrough (1× is the industry floor), but higher-minimum than some competitors (100 SC vs 10 SC at McLuck). The bank transfer timeline of 3-5 business days is competitive once KYC is cleared.
The single biggest operational tip: complete KYC on day one. Every other delay risk is downstream of that step. New players who verify identity before they have anything to redeem will experience faster, smoother first cashouts.
